It's a good point that you make about individual responsibility and power. That was definitely an ongoing theme-Buffy deciding how much of everything should even be her responsibility, Faith who got blinded by the power and had to learn that might doesn't make right, the whole magic corruption arc with Willow... And a lot of the Wolfram & Hart stuff on Angel-do you do the right thing knowing what kind of contract you've signed? How far can you change things in the system? (And, honestly, how does a toxic workplace break your sense of morality and professional norms?) Anne's character arc was awesome! ~Dreamer~
